Paperback. Etat : New. Print on Demand. This book, a compilation of reprinted papers and addresses, examines the historical relationship between libraries and schools. It begins with Charles Francis Adams, Jr.'s 1876 address on the importance of school-library cooperation and follows the evolution of this idea through the work of notable librarians like Samuel S. Green and Melvil Dewey. The book traces the development of school-based libraries, extracurricular activities, and the role of the teacher in encouraging students' use of library resources. It emphasizes the reciprocal benefits of collaboration, showcasing examples of successful programs and highlighting the shared goal of fostering a love of reading and lifelong learning. The insights presented in this book underscore the crucial role of libraries and schools in shaping individuals' intellectual growth and empowering them to become active and informed citizens.
